Transaction 75a7fe8c7946832491cc045002ace2830a838325b3379b4332b54233d0304f61
1 Input
1 Output
-
75a7fe8c7946832491cc045002ace2830a838325b3379b4332b54233d0304f61:0
- value
- 119354
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 963ff22f39b0168bce594251873e31b95db4e696 OP_EQUAL
- address
- 3FPTtNDTUbrFGHGSj4jSye5AaqE9mZTA86